GdS: Beckenbauer comparisons, few chances - why Odogu remains Milan's mystery
"David Odogu remains perhaps the most mysterious signings AC Milan have made in recent times, as he continues to struggle for minutes. La Gazzetta dello Sport recall how after winning the U17 World Cup with Germany two years ago, some German media dubbed Odogu 'the future Beckenbauer'. This accolade is currently hanging in the balance, awaiting confirmation, and perhaps risks being a bit too heavy on the shoulders of a 19-year-old."
"Small squad but no chances Odogu has also received a few calls from Milan Futuro boss Massimo Oddo. Three, to be precise, but in the meantime, that significant zero remains under Massimiliano Allegri. He made his debut for Milan in the Coppa Italia, getting 12 minutes against Lecce in the round of 32, but nothing in the league. The situation is notable because the squad, as is well known, is small."
David Odogu was signed by AC Milan in the summer for €7m plus €3m in bonuses as a targeted investment for the future. He won the 2023 U17 World Cup and European Championship with Germany and was once dubbed 'the future Beckenbauer' by some German media. Odogu has not played a single minute in Serie A and is the only Milan outfield player with zero league minutes. He made a 12-minute debut in the Coppa Italia against Lecce. The squad uses a three-man defence with five central defenders, limiting rotation opportunities. A loan move for the second half of the season appears likely.
